Integrative Massage blends various techniques such as craniosacral therapy, myofascial release, energy work, and traditional massage to address physical, emotional, and energetic imbalances.

  • 
Unlike traditional massage, Integrative Massage combines multiple modalities and holistic techniques tailored to your unique needs, promoting healing on all levels.

  • 
Each session begins with a consultation to determine your needs. The treatment may include massage, craniosacral therapy, energy work, or a combination, all aimed at creating deep relaxation and healing.
